# PPRO: Revolutionizing Memory Retrieval for Conversational Agents

PPRO aims to enhance long-term conversational agents by optimizing memory retrieval based on user profiles. This approach promises significant improvements in personalized interactions.

Long-term conversational agents that remember past interactions could transform our interactions with AI. But here's the catch: memory is only useful when it retrieves the right information for the right user. Current memory-augmented language models have been building compact memory banks, but they're often constrained by query-centric similarity or rigid ranking rules. These methods barely scratch the surface of user-specific relevance.

## Introducing PPRO

The proposed solution, Profile-guided Personalized Retrieval [Optimization](/glossary/optimization) (PPRO), steps into this gap with a retrieval-centric framework that prioritizes user-aware and optimizable memory retrieval. By constructing episodic and semantic memory banks from dialogue histories, PPRO derives a user profile that acts as a personalized prior. This allows the system to consider user attributes, preferences, and relationships when ranking memory retrievals.

PPRO doesn't stop there. It trains a query rewriter using Group Relative Policy Optimization, focusing on both the quality of evidence retrieval and the downstream answer quality. Importantly, this happens while keeping the memory banks and answer model fixed. The results? Experiments on LoCoMo and LongMemEval-S reveal consistent gains over both [training](/glossary/training)-free and training-based memory systems.

## The Real Impact

Why should we care about these technical details? Because the intersection is real. Ninety percent of the projects aren't. Personalized retrieval optimization could be a breakthrough for industries relying on AI for customer interactions, education, and more. Imagine an AI that doesn't just remember your last question but understands your preferences and context.

PPRO's approach highlights retrieval optimization as essential for personalized long-term memory use. But let's be clear: slapping a model on a [GPU](/glossary/gpu) rental isn't a convergence thesis. The real innovation lies in integrating user profiles into retrieval processes.
